Copper Piping Installation Questions
What is copper piping commonly used for? Copper piping is often used for plumbing, including water supply lines, due to its durability and corrosion resistance.
How long does copper piping typically last? Copper pipes generally have a lifespan of 50 years or more with proper installation and maintenance.
Are copper pipes resistant to freezing temperatures? Copper pipes can be affected by freezing, which may cause them to crack or burst if not properly insulated.
What are the benefits of choosing copper piping for a property? Copper piping offers reliable performance, longevity, and resistance to bacteria growth in water systems.
